Crucial Redis Monitoring Metrics You Must Watch

Scalegrid

Key metrics like throughput, request latency, and memory utilization are essential for assessing Redis health, with tools like the MONITOR command and Redis-benchmark for latency and throughput analysis and MEMORY USAGE/STATS commands for evaluating memory. Building Netflix’s Distributed Tracing Infrastructure

The Netflix TechBlog

We took a hybrid head-based sampling approach that allows for recording 100% of traces for a specific and configurable set of requests, while continuing to randomly sample traffic per the policy set at ingestion point. Our engineering teams tuned their services for performance after factoring in increased resource utilization due to tracing.
